This show-stopper dessert will amaze everyone when they see it, and then amaze them all over again when they taste it. Beneath the figs lies a beautiful vanilla sponge soaked with a sweet rum syrup, a light vanilla custard cream and a chunky fruit jam. The best part is that this is all way easier than it looks to pull together. You can also make it ahead, and it’s easily transportable in its bowl if you’ve been asked to bring dessert. You’ll need to start this recipe a day ahead, and you’ll need a 21cm-wide (top) x 11cm-high, 2.5L-capacity bowl and a 42cm x 30cm baking tray. Credit: Brett Stevens

This fig, orange and cardamom cake is made for autumn entertaining
Let beautiful seasonal figs shine in this striking cake, which is much easier than it might look to put together. For the rest of the year, when fresh figs are unavailable, you can still enjoy this cake simply iced, or an even simpler un-iced version, as it only requires dried figs. You’ll need an 18cm round cake pan and a piping bag or zip-lock bag for this recipe. Credit: Brett Stevens
